Internet Technology Manager SOP Examples

1. Network Infrastructure Management: This SOP outlines the procedures for managing the network infrastructure within the organization. It includes tasks such as configuring routers and switches, monitoring network performance, and troubleshooting network issues. The scope of this SOP covers all network devices and systems used by the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for ensuring the proper implementation and maintenance of the network infrastructure. This SOP references other related SOPs such as Network Security Management and Network Documentation.

2. System Administration: The purpose of this SOP is to define the procedures for managing and maintaining the organization’s computer systems. It includes tasks such as installing and configuring operating systems, managing user accounts, and performing system backups. The scope of this SOP covers all computer systems used by the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ing system administration activities and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as System Patch Management and Disaster Recovery.

3. IT Security Management: This SOP outlines the procedures for managing the security of the organization’s IT infrastructure. It includes tasks such as implementing access controls, conducting regular security audits, and responding to security incidents. The scope of this SOP covers all IT systems and data within the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ing IT security management and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as Incident Response and Security Awareness Training.

4. Change Management: The purpose of this SOP is to establish a structured process for managing changes to the organization’s IT environment. It includes tasks such as assessing change requests, planning and implementing changes, and reviewing the impact of changes. The scope of this SOP covers all changes to IT systems, applications, and infrastructure.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ing the change management process and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as Release Management and Configuration Management.

5. IT Asset Management: This SOP defines the procedures for managing the organization’s IT assets, including hardware, software, and licenses. It includes tasks such as tracking asset inventory, conducting regular audits, and managing software licenses. The scope of this SOP covers all IT assets owned or used by the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ing IT asset management and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as Procurement and Vendor Management.

6. Incident Response: The purpose of this SOP is to establish a framework for responding to and resolving IT incidents in a timely and efficient manner. It includes tasks such as incident identification, classification, and resolution. The scope of this SOP covers all IT incidents reported within the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ing the incident response process and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as Problem Management and Service Desk Operations.

7. Backup and Recovery: This SOP outlines the procedures for backing up and recovering the organization’s critical data and systems. It includes tasks such as defining backup schedules, testing backup integrity, and restoring data in case of a disaster. The scope of this SOP covers all critical data and systems within the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ing backup and recovery activities and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as Disaster Recovery and Data Retention.

8. IT Governance: The purpose of this SOP is to establish a framework for managing and aligning IT activities with the organization’s goals and objectives. It includes tasks such as defining IT policies and procedures, conducting IT risk assessments, and monitoring IT performance. The scope of this SOP covers all IT activities within the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ing IT governance and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as IT Strategy and IT Budgeting.

9. Documentation Management: This SOP defines the procedures for creating, organizing, and maintaining IT documentation within the organization. It includes tasks such as documenting system configurations, network diagrams, and user manuals. The scope of this SOP covers all IT documentation produced or used by the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ing documentation management and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as Change Management and Incident Response.

10. IT Training and Development: The purpose of this SOP is to establish a framework for providing IT training and development opportunities to employees within the organization. It includes tasks such as identifying training needs, developing training programs, and evaluating training effectiveness. The scope of this SOP covers all IT training and development activities within the organization. The Internet Technology Manager is responsible for overseeing IT training and development and ensuring compliance with this SOP. This SOP may reference other related SOPs such as Performance Management and Succession Planning
